BAM is a part of a non-profit organization named Auxin360. Auxin is a hormone in plants that causes plants to grow toward light. It is the reason you will occasionally see a tree in the forest grow sideways and then shoot up to the sky. It is growing toward the light. The analogy is pretty straightforward. We all have light within us that longs to connect to the greater light in the world.
Helping people discover the light that is within them and then letting that light shine is the focus of all of the Auxin360 efforts, including BAM. The vision of BAM is simple and powerful: Equipping a new generation of men to be strong, healthy leaders in their families, work, communities, and the world
BAM has three interrelated components.
The first component is building the father/son relationship. Recognizing that most fathers have good intentions but do not have a good strategy, we have created a dynamic and very effective structure for father/son events that dramatically improves communication and the bond between fathers and sons. Combining adventure, focused discussion, and intentional activities where the sons take the lead, these events create a powerful system to empower both the sons and the fathers.
Our goal is not simply to lead events ourselves, though. We have created a dynamic curriculum for faith communities, schools, camps, and communities to use so that they can build strong father/son relationships. Just leading events ourselves we can impact a few people. Equipping thousands of organizations to lead events can help us change the world.
The second component is creating a network of fathers around the country who are committed to supporting the next generation of young men. Working through faith communities, schools, and communities, we will create an ongoing father/son small group structure that builds supportive community, positive encouragement, and lasting relationships. Imagine the change that can occur in a community when you have dozens of small groups of fathers and sons meeting together for fun, adventure, and growth.
The third component is the creation of a leadership institute for young men. This is not your average leadership institute. This is like a Jedi Knight leadership institute, equipping young men to be bold, confident, positive leaders who make a positive impact wherever they are. But again, we don’t want to simply lead a leadership institute here in Danielsville, GA. We want to equip leaders across the globe to train young men to be strong, confident, positive leaders.
